Is carbon dioxide a iconic or covalent compound
igomit [66]
It is a covalant bond. Because any compound made up of nonmetals will be covalant. Compounds made up of a non metal and metal willl form a ionic compund. :)

a gas evolved during the fermentation of glucose has a volume of 0.78L at 20.1C and 1 atm. What is the volume of this gas if the
slavikrds [6]
To do this, you need to use the combined gas law 

(P1)(V1) / T(1) = (P2) (V2) / 2

For temperature, convert to Kelvins
T1= 20.1C + 273 
T1= 293.1 K 

T2= 40 +273 
T2= 313 K 

Now sub the numbers into the formula 

(1) (0.78) / 293.1 = (1.2) (V2) / 313 

0.00266 = 1.2(V2) / 313 
0.833 = 1.2(v2) 

V2= 0.69 L is the new volume
